Insurance in Erie: the local picture
Erie, CO presents a dynamic insurance market due to its rapid population growth and significant exposure to natural perils. Insurers should note the high frequency of hail events, particularly during the late spring and summer months, which drives property claims. Additionally, identified flood risks mean that flood insurance is a relevant consideration for property owners in the area.
Population: 30038 (2020)
- The Town of Erie's population was 30,038 at the 2020 United States Census, representing a 65.64% increase since the 2010 Census. — Population growth can indicate expanding housing markets and increased demand for property insurance.
- Major employers in Erie proper include the Town of Erie, Magnum Plastics, and Safeway. — Key employers provide economic stability, impacting commercial insurance needs and employment-related risks.
- The Erie, CO area has had 30 reports of on-the-ground hail by trained spotters and 81 occasions of radar-detected hail, including 5 in the past year. — Frequent hail events indicate a high risk for property damage, directly affecting homeowners and auto insurance claims.
- Erie, CO has experienced 25 hail events of 1 inch or greater in diameter over the last 10 years, with the peak season between May and July. — This specific data point highlights the severity and seasonality of hail risk, crucial for underwriting and risk assessment.
- Properties in Erie, CO have identified flood risk, with detailed interactive flood maps available from the First Street Foundation. — Flood risk necessitates flood insurance considerations for property owners, especially in identified high-risk zones.

Insurance requirements in Colorado
Colorado is an at-fault (tort) state: every driver must carry liability insurance, and insurers must offer uninsured/underinsured-motorist coverage. Colorado leads the nation in hail damage along the Front Range, and large stretches of the state carry real wildfire exposure — so roof condition, replacement-cost dwelling limits, and wildfire mitigation weigh heavily for homeowners.
